The official funeral ceremony of the poet Muthaffar Al-Nawab took place at the headquarters of the Writers' Union and in the presence of Prime Minister Mustafa al-Kadhimi.
The correspondent of the Iraqi News Agency (INA) said that, "The official funeral ceremony of the late poet Muthaffar Al-Nawab began at the headquarters of the Writers' Union in central Baghdad," noting that "Prime Minister Mustafa Al-Kadhimi presented the croweds of mourners and in the presence of the Minister of Culture, Hassan Nadhem."
The body of the great iconic poet Muthaffar Al-Nawab arrived home from Sharjah in UAE. The poet Muzaffar al-Nawab died on Friday in a Sharjah hospital at the age of 88 after prolonged illness.
Prime Minister, Mustafa Al-Kadhimi directed to transfer the body of the late Iraqi poet Muthaffar Al-Nawab by presidential plane, to be buried in the homeland,” according to a statement issued by his office.
